Evaluation of a partial-band jammer with Gaussian-shaped spectrum against FH/MFSK

نویسندگان

  • Hyuck M. Kwon
  • Leonard E. Miller
  • Jhong S. Lee
چکیده

It is often assumed in system analyses that a partial-band noise jammer against a frequency-hopped M-ary frequency shift keying (FHMFSK) communication system has a rectangular spectrum. The rectangular spectrum is, of course, unrealizable, and so it is of interest to consider more realistic spectrums, such as those where a jammer uses a bandpass filter before amplifying the jamming noise. In this paper, a Gaussian-shaped filter is used to represent a class of bandpass filters. Clearly, this is a more realistic shape than the ideal rectangular shape. In addition, it can be analyzed easily by a reasonable approximation, i.e., a Gaussian-shaped spectrum that is constant over each hopped M-ary signaling band. Numerical results indicate that such a Gaussian-shaped partial-band noise jammer has nearly the same effects as an ideal rectangular-shaped partial-band noise jammer with an equivalent bandwidth.
